Transaction d6ff77bf8eca57502289599583635527685f702a3fc0f8eadcdea7020257173e
2 Input
2 Outputs
- d6ff77bf8eca57502289599583635527685f702a3fc0f8eadcdea7020257173e:0
- d6ff77bf8eca57502289599583635527685f702a3fc0f8eadcdea7020257173e:1
value 4983240
address 396gNAkULMyE8D2opChHkJv5xNJdXRLRdW
value 343431
address bc1qmc7e877dwnrnwprx2smlfjf7l724tsv6k8ffew